Mineral-Based Electrical Bushing Market was valued at USD 1.89 billion in 2023 and is set to grow at a CAGR of 5.9% between 2024 and 2032. There is a growing demand for high-performance insulation solutions due to the expansion of power infrastructure projects. Mineral-based electrical bushings, known for their superior insulating properties and durability, are increasingly preferred for high-voltage applications. Rapid urbanization and industrial growth in emerging economies are leading to substantial investments in power infrastructure.
The global shift towards renewable energy sources, such as wind and solar power, has necessitated the integration of advanced electrical components that can withstand diverse environmental conditions. Mineral-based bushings are favored in renewable energy applications due to their resilience and reliability.

Innovations in material science have led to the development of advanced mineral-based compounds that enhance the performance and longevity of electrical bushings. These improvements are critical in reducing maintenance costs and increasing the lifespan of power equipment. Increasingly stringent regulatory standards for safety and efficiency in the power sector are driving the adoption of high-quality insulation solutions. Compliance with these standards necessitates the use of advanced bushing technologies that can meet rigorous performance criteria. Ensuring grid stability and reliability is a top priority for utilities worldwide. High-performance mineral-based bushings play a crucial role in minimizing outages and enhancing the resilience of power grids, making them an integral component of modern power systems.
Based on insulation, the porcelain segment is projected to reach USD 940 million by 2032. Innovations in manufacturing processes and material science have led to the development of advanced porcelain formulations that enhance the electrical and mechanical properties of bushings. These advancements improve the performance and extend the lifespan of the bushings.
Based on end use, the utility segment is set to grow at a CAGR of more than 4.9% through 2032. Globally, there is a substantial increase in investments towards upgrading and expanding power infrastructure. This trend is particularly pronounced in emerging economies where the need for robust power transmission systems is critical to support rapid industrialization and urbanization. Moreover, modernizing aging grid infrastructure is a priority for many developed and developing countries, which will further surge the product adoption across the utility sector.
Asia Pacific mineral-based electrical bushing market is projected to surpass USD 1.04 billion by 2032. The Asia Pacific region is experiencing unprecedented industrialization and urbanization, leading to increased demand for reliable and efficient power transmission solutions. Countries such as China, India, and Southeast Asian nations are investing heavily in power infrastructure to support economic growth. There is a significant expansion in power generation and transmission infrastructure across the region. This includes the construction of new power plants, transmission lines, and substations, all of which require high-performance mineral-based electrical bushings to ensure reliable operation.
